The mix of HPLC-MS is oriented in direction of the specific detection and possible identification of substances in the existence of other chemical substances. On the other hand, it really is difficult to interface the liquid chromatography to some mass-spectrometer, since every one of the solvents need to be removed first. The popular used interface incorporates electrospray ionization, atmospheric tension photoionization, and thermospray ionization.

While every one of these fundamental rules hold true for all chromatographic separations, HPLC was formulated as strategy to unravel several of the shortcomings of ordinary liquid chromatography. Vintage liquid chromatography has quite a few intense constraints like a separation system. When the solvent is driven by gravity, the separation may be very slow, and If your solvent is pushed by vacuum, in an ordinary packed column, the plate height will increase use of hplc machine as well as effect on the vacuum is negated. The restricting factor in liquid chromatography was originally the dimensions with the column packing, the moment columns could be packed with particles as little as 3 µm, more rapidly separations may very well be executed in lesser, narrower, columns.
